Quick stack math
- Odd numbers read effortless: 1 necklace + 2 bracelets, or 3 dainty rings.
- Vary texture, keep color cohesive: mix tennis sparkle with smooth chain links.
- Give your statement space: if the earrings are bold, go simpler on the neck.
Sizing and care: the tiny tweaks that make it luxe
Getting the right fit
- Bracelets
- Measure your wrist with a soft tape or a strip of paper, then add 0.5–1 inch for a comfy fit.
- Common lengths: women 6.5–7.5 in; men 7.5–8.5 in; kids 5–6.5 in. Opt for extenders if you’re between sizes or plan to stack.
- Anklets
- Measure just above the ankle bone and add 0.5–1 inch for movement.
- Typical lengths: women 9–10 in; men 10–11 in; kids 7–9 in. If you like a looser drape for sandals, add an extra 0.5 in.
- Necklaces
- Build range: a 16–18 in base chain, an 18–20 in mid, and a 20–22 in top layer for easy stacking across necklines.
Caring for 14K/18K gold-plated pieces
- Last on, first off: jewelry goes on after lotions, perfume, and SPF; take it off before the gym, shower, or swim.
- Gentle clean: wipe with a soft, dry cloth after wear to remove oils; use mild soap and water sparingly, then dry completely.
- Smart storage: keep pieces in separate pouches or compartments to avoid scratches and tangles. Reuse Rochas’s recyclable packaging for tidy, eco-friendly storage.
- Rotate your heroes: give plated favorites a rest between wears to extend the life of the finish.
- Travel tip: pack a small microfiber cloth and a few tiny zip bags to keep chains untangled and shine intact.
